A regenerative air sweeper uses a powerful blast of air to loosen dirt and debris, then immediately vacuums it into the hopper. This closed-loop air system allows the sweeper to clean thoroughly while minimizing dust and debris left behind.
Regenerative air sweepers make quick work and are ideal for municipal streets, parking lots, and construction sites. They are especially effective for removing fine dust, sand, leaves, and debris while being gentle on finished surfaces—making them a reliable choice for routine maintenance, pre-paving work, and line painting preparation.

A high‑dump sweeper is designed to collect heavy debris efficiently using a large rear main broom that transfers material into the hopper, it then elevates the hopper to unload directly into larger containers, dump trucks, or designated disposal areas. This elevated dumping capability reduces downtime and improves workflow on busy job sites.
High‑dump sweepers are ideal for industrial facilities, construction zones, municipal operations, recycling yards, and large commercial properties. They excel at removing bulkier materials such as gravel, millings, packed dirt, and job‑site debris. Their ability to offload at height makes them especially valuable for high‑volume cleanup jobs. They are the ideal sweeper where debris collection and disposal need to happen quickly and continuously.

Single‑axle water trucks, ranging from 1,500 to 2,000 imp. gallons in capacity, provide a compact and efficient solution for on‑site water delivery. They offer greater maneuverability on sites with limited space.
Available options include:
- Mechanical watering arm
- Front spray jets
- Electric hose reel
- Side draft water connection

Tandem‑axle water trucks, ranging from 3,500 to 4,000 imp. gallon in capacity, deliver high‑volume water transport and reliable performance for demanding job sites. Their added stability, weight distribution and payload make them ideal for large‑scale dust control, soil compaction, pool filling, and heavy construction support. With powerful spray systems, these trucks are built to keep projects moving efficiently wherever consistent water supply is essential.
Available options include:
- Front and side spray jets
- Electric hose reel
- Side draft water connection
- Rear dust control jets
- Self-filling/drafting trucks
